Output efc748201a35e3b7a7eec531542f5d19df472020ada264e7a09c027490011fd0:3

value
37166903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62bff1a97f7c8dd8fbf41e665c2f3a48e1226ca4 OP_EQUAL
address
MGuJPjQdSbEYZjjLMubq8KKHYUMoWa8yZK
transaction
efc748201a35e3b7a7eec531542f5d19df472020ada264e7a09c027490011fd0
spent
true